What Question-Based Content Strategy Looks Like
Most B2B content programs still organize around keywords and topic clusters. question based content strategy flips that — every page targets a specific buyer question, every answer is direct, and the program is measured by AI citation share, not just organic ranking.
RocketSales builds question-based programs in three phases. First, we mine 200-500 real buyer questions from sales calls, support tickets, Reddit, and prompt research. Second, we map each question to a page type — short answer page, comparison page, deep-dive guide, or FAQ insert. Third, we sequence production by buyer-journey priority so the highest-leverage questions ship first.
The work flows through our AEO and GEO services. Every page is structured for direct answers (AEO) and marked up with FAQ schema, Article schema, and clean H2/H3 hierarchy (GEO). The result is a content library that performs across organic search, Google AI Overviews, Perplexity, and ChatGPT — all measured weekly.
